Bandipora Road Accident Claims Life of 19-Year-Old, Second Youth Injured

BANDIPORA, October 9, 2025 —Bandipora Road Accident A tragic road accident claimed the life of a 19-year-old youth and left another seriously injured on the Ashtangoo-Aloosa road in north Kashmir’s Bandipora district on Thursday afternoon.

The incident occurred when a motorcycle carrying two young men met with an accident under circumstances that remain unclear. Local sources reported that the riders lost control of their vehicle along the winding stretch connecting Ashtangoo and Aloosa.

The deceased has been identified as Ubaid Manzoor Khan, son of Manzoor Ahmad Khan, from Aloosa Gath. His companion, 18-year-old Azad Gul, son of Ghulam Mohammad Matta from the same locality, sustained injuries in the crash.

Upon receiving information about the accident, local residents and police personnel quickly arrived at the scene. The injured youth was immediately transported to a nearby medical facility for treatment, while Ubaid was declared dead at the hospital.

A police official confirmed that authorities have registered a case and initiated an investigation to determine the exact cause of the accident. “We are looking into all possible factors that may have led to this tragic incident,” the officer stated.

The sudden demise of the young Ubaid has plunged the Aloosa Gath community into mourning, with neighbors and relatives gathering at the family’s residence to offer condolences. Local residents have expressed concern over road safety in the area and called for improved safety measures along the stretch where the accident occurred.
